WebMar 30, 2024 · Some of the defining characteristics of a Sovereign Gold bond are: SGBs, like any other bonds, pay periodic interest. The interest rate paid on an SGB is 2.5% annually, paid twice a year. The tenure of the bond is 8 years. However, you can redeem the bond anytime after 5 years. You can also sell in the secondary market. Web- Sovereign Gold Bonds are an investment scheme to invest in gold (24 carat gold) as part of a subscription. Bonds are issued in units of the value of grams. The minimal unit is worth a gram of gold. - An annual fixed interest rate of 2.5% is applied, and payouts of interest are made every 6 months. - The bonds are invested in with a fixed tenure.

WebFeb 19, 2024 · As you can see in the image above, The total invested amount is Rs.24,195, the total value of the invested amount in SGB is Rs.55,758 and the interest earned from … WebDec 17, 2024 · While banks are offering 6.70-7 per cent interest on one-year deposits, gold bonds bear interest at the rate of 2.50 per cent (fixed rate) per annum on the amount of initial investment. Interest will be credited semi-annually to the bank account of the investor and the last interest will be payable on maturity along with the principal.

WebDec 2, 2024 · Investors have to pay the issue price in cash and the bonds will be redeemed in cash on maturity. The bond is issued by the RBI on behalf of the government.
